2 stepsTechnology has indeed created avenues for the spread of social vices while simultaneously offering powerful tools to combat them. On one hand, the internet and social media platforms facilitate the rapid dissemination of harmful content, such as hate speech, misinformation, and extremist ideologies, which can radicalize individuals or incite violence. They also enable cyberbullying, online scams, and the illicit trade of goods and services through encrypted channels or the dark web, making it harder for authorities to track.
On the other hand, technology is crucial in curbing these vices. Advanced surveillance systems like CCTV and facial recognition aid in identifying criminals and preventing crimes. Digital forensics helps law enforcement trace online activities and gather evidence. Educational platforms and social media campaigns can raise awareness about the dangers of vices and promote positive social behaviors. Furthermore, AI and data analytics can detect patterns of illicit activity, identify vulnerable individuals, and flag harmful content for removal, while parental control software helps protect children from inappropriate material.
When it comes to training children, methods that involve capital punishment (interpreted here as harsh, punitive, or physically harmful discipline) are widely condemned due to their negative impact on a child's development and well-being. Instead, alternative methods focus on fostering a child's understanding, self-control, and positive behavior.
Recommended alternatives include positive reinforcement, where good behavior is acknowledged and rewarded to encourage its repetition. Setting clear boundaries and expectations helps children understand what is acceptable and what is not, along with consistent, logical consequences for missteps. Time-outs can provide a child with space to calm down and reflect on their actions. Teaching problem-solving skills and emotional regulation empowers children to manage their feelings and navigate challenges constructively. Open communication and active listening are vital for understanding a child's perspective and building a trusting relationship, allowing guidance to be more effective than punishment.
